Chimeric evidence for a role of the connexin cytoplasmic loop in gap junction channel gating.
Pflugers Archiv : European journal of physiology - 1 Apr 1996
Wang X, Li L, Peracchia L L, Peracchia C
Abstract excerpt
Gap junction channels are regulated by gates that close upon exposure to 100% CO2, probably via an increase in intracellular Ca2+ concentration, [Ca2+]i.
